Garland and Lights

This decoration idea is a classic, simple and beautiful way to decorate your staircase. Wrapping garland around the handrail and adding lights can make your staircase look festive and elegant.

This decor is suitable for anyone who wants to keep things simple yet give off a classic Christmas vibe. This décor is inexpensive and easy to make even for those who prefer simple DIYs.

Candlesticks and Greens

If you wish to coordinate your staircase décor with elegant holiday-themed candlesticks and greenery, this is the perfect decor idea for you. Arranging candlesticks at intervals along the steps and stylizing them with holly and pine branches is a beautiful way to dress up your home’s staircases.

This decoration idea requires more effort than the garland and light decor but is still easily achievable. You can purchase candlesticks and greenery in local stores or online.

Ornaments and Ribbon

This decor brings a unique look to traditional Christmas décor by incorporating ornaments into the garland and tying ribbon around the handrail.

This decoration improves on the traditional garland and light décor to create an excellent modern twist to the classic Christmas decorations. It consists of hanging small ornaments from the garland, such as candy canes, small Santa or snowman figurines, little gift boxes, or balls.

Holiday Cards and Pom-Poms

Make your Christmas cards the star of your holiday decorating when you use them as your staircase décor. This decor involves displaying your holiday cards on the garland, and adding pom-poms for that homemade feel.

This decoration idea includes using holiday cards you have received or bought during the holiday season to display them in a way that creates a warm and inviting atmosphere. It also doesn't need any effort or expense since all you need is to staple your cards onto your decorated garland.

Miniature Trees

This decor is perfect for those who want to add something unique into their staircase décor. Placing mini Christmas trees on each step with additional lights, glitter or fake snow is a great way to add some holiday fun into your home's staircases.

This decoration is a bit pricier than the other ideas, but the result makes up for the price. It's a festive and glamorous option that adds an extra touch to your home’s holiday decor.

Here are some of the most frequently asked questions about dazzling your staircase with festive flair:

  1. What are some popular Christmas decoration ideas for stairs?

    Some of the most popular Christmas decoration ideas for stairs include:

    • Garlands made of evergreen branches, pinecones, and berries
    • Bows and ribbons in festive colors like red, green, and gold
    • Ornaments hung from the railing or tucked into the garland
    • Twinkling lights wrapped around the railing or draped over the garland
  2. How can I make my staircase look more festive without spending a lot of money?

    You don't have to spend a lot of money to make your staircase look festive. Here are some inexpensive ideas:

    • Make your own garland by cutting evergreen branches from your yard and tying them together with twine or wire
    • Repurpose old ornaments or buy inexpensive ones at a dollar store and use them to decorate your garland
    • Use ribbon or fabric scraps to tie bows around the spindles or newel post
    • Hang a wreath on the wall at the base of your staircase
  3. Can I decorate my staircase if I have small children or pets?

    Yes, you can still decorate your staircase if you have small children or pets. Just be sure to take some precautions:

    • Don't use decorations that are small enough to be swallowed
    • Avoid using artificial snow or anything that could be harmful if ingested
    • Secure your decorations carefully so they can't be pulled down or knocked over
    • Consider using battery-operated candles instead of real ones
